Aequatio-Space avatar Aequatio-Space commented on May 27, 2024

in run_cc.py you can see that restore_path is being linked to testing.

if exp_info['restore_path']['model_path'] == '':
restore_config = None
else:
restore_config = exp_info['restore_path']
if 'render' in exp_info['restore_path']:
render_config = {
"evaluation_interval": 1,
"evaluation_num_episodes": 100,
"evaluation_num_workers": 1,
"evaluation_config": {
"record_env": False,
"render_env": True,
}
}

To restore training progress, perhaps try resume=True in the ray.init? Or you can also rewrite the relevant logic to circumvent this issue.
